Oplev vores madspecialiteter, kendt over hele verden: Parmigiano Reggiano, traditionel balsamicoeddike og Lambrusco rødvin. Med guiden lærer du alle hemmelighederne om disse familietraditioner. Lær alle faserne af produktionen af parmesanost: Besøg og se køerne, skabelsen af et hjul og ældningen. En smagning vil blive serveret i slutningen af turen ... med frisk ricotta også! Balsamicoeddiken kaldes "Sort Guld", fordi den har brug for en lang og tålmodig proces på min. 12 år! En smagning af tre forskellige lagrede balsamicoeddike afslutter denne tur. Du vil fortsætte med at smage Eddiken under frokosten... også til dessert! Besøget af vinproducenten starter med en guidet tur inde i det private museum for vintraditioner, og det fortsætter ind i kældrene og produktionsområdet og afsluttes med en smagning af 3 forskellige vine. Lambrusco og Pignoletto er vinen i dette område. Den guidede tur starter først med et besøg på Museum of Wine, Traditions and Ancient Works, hvor guiden vil introducere dig til, hvordan jorden og vinen blev bearbejdet i fortiden; så fortsætter det med besøget i kældrene, og du vil opdage, hvordan vinen er produceret. Turen afsluttes med en smagning på min. 3 vine.
Guidet parmesanostfabrikstur med smagning. Guidet tur rundt i produktionsområderne, aldringslageret og køerne. Smagningen til sidst inkluderer Parmigiano, frisk ricotta og balsamicoeddike.
Lær og opdag, hvorfor balsamicoeddiken her kaldes "Sort guld". Den guidede tur vil vise dig historien og procesfaserne i denne familiemadtradition. Smag til sidst
